Title Pedogenesis on the Sefton Coastal Dunes
Undertaken by Jennifer Millington
Project Description
The British coastline is a vital national heritage. Therefore, it is very important to have an understanding of the complexity of the coastal system and subsequent responses to rapid environmental change, such as coastal erosion, rising sea levels and climatic change. The geomorphological processes active on this part of the coast, along with a sound knowledge on the local habitat environments and their location in relation to the coast, have previously been recognised. This project aims to bring together these two issues, which have generally been kept separate, to determine how the habitat environments will adjust and migrate in response to the changing coastal landforms and sea level rise. The soil system is an essential component of the coastal environment and is fundamental to the understanding of the complex range of environmental, ecological and hydrological processes and for contributing towards their efficient and effective environmental management. The nature and extent of soil development in the Sefton dune environments, ranging from open dune to slack areas, will be investigated in this project as a major determinant of the content and availability of nutrients and water available to plants, therefore determining the habitat environment of a specific area. In regard to future duneland ecological management, analyses and comparisons of the characteristics of both the modern soils and the now buried soils of the past will be carried out throughout the entire Sefton dune system, with an aim to model habitat migration patterns. This soil study on the Sefton coastal dunes will meet a number of strategic objectives: 1. Provide fundamental information to the understanding of environmental processes active on the coast. 2. Contribute to effective management strategies. 3. Actively inform the public of the value of the soil resource as an integral component of the coastal system
